This beautiful pre WWII radio has great styling, gorgeous front veneer and a distinctive oval metal bezel. Using various veneers and solid woods, it is very well made with quality craftsmanship and design. It not only looks charming, it sounds good too. With six tubes, it has very good sensitivity, selectivity and reception. It also has tone control for your listening preference. S with all of the radios I restore, it has been gone over with the utmost attention to detail. The cabinet was stripped of the old varnish and lacquer, keeping the original stain. It was then nourished and rejuvenated and the top and bottom trim were redone with brown mahogany toners. The entire cabinet was then given seven coats of clear lacquer with excellent results. There is some veneer edges missing from the top as can be seen in the photos. There is also a very small chip in the right upper front veneer. None of those detract from the overall appearance of the radio. The multicolored dial face is in excellent condition with crisp and clear graphics that are nicely lighted and there is an indicator that shows which band is selected. The original dial cover has been polished and is in very good condition. The bezel is in excellent original condition. He knobs are replacements that perfectly match the trim toners and have been polished. The grill cloth has replaced. The power cord was replaced. Felt pads were added to the bottom to protect your furniture. Electronically, the chassis was restored, cleaned and serviced, with all paper/wax and electrolytic capacitors replaced with new ones. Tubes and resistors were tested and replaced as needed. All controls and contacts were detail cleaned and lubricated. Wiring and other components were replaced as needed. The now unused original electrolytic capacitors remain in place to maintain the original look of the chassis. The original Jensen speaker is in excellent condition and sounds great. The radio was aligned, peaked and tuned for optimal reception and quality of sound using the nine foot external antenna (provided). This is a fairly rare radio with a very appealing presence and it. Certainly demands a place of distinction. Just imagine all of the news of the world, music and stories this wonderful radio has broadcast. Now 84 years old and newly restored inside and out, it will continue to provide many more years of enjoyment if well cared for. Note: Tube radios consist of a variety of vacuum tubes, capacitors, resistors and other electronic components. This radio has been disassembled, cleaned, and components tested. All non-functioning or suspect components were replaced. Vacuum tubes are similar to light bulbs in that an interior filament heats up inside the vacuum tube. When the filament burns out, the tube will need to be replaced. The tubes in this radio are in good. The longevity of the tube and its filaments is related to the length of time the radio is operated and the frequency of turning the radio power on and off. Here we have an absolutely stunning 1935 Coronado model 578 tombstone radio featuring a beautiful American Walnut cabinet, bright back lit dial, step up top, marquetry inlays and outstanding performance. Cabinet: The American Walnut cabinet is simply stunning. Contrasting wood tones and grains flow throughout the entire set. The step up top and marquetry inlays add to the elegance and style. A large intricate cut grill not only looks great but allows for optimal sound from the speaker. Jet black trim and base finish the cabinet off perfectly. This beauty is sure to add elegance and class to any room of the home or office you choose to display it in. Dial: The airplane style dial is a real eye catcher. It lights nice and bright with a warm orange glow. The dial itself features an ivory background with the Kilocycles scale at the top and Meters at the bottom. The dial glass is clear and free from and chips, cracks or breaks. All three knobs are in perfect shape and control volume, tuning and on/off. Grill Cloth: The 1930s style grill cloth is a fine reproduction featuring a classic black and gold color with a leaf / wave design. Chassis: All tubes in the 5 tube chassis were tested with any weak tubes being replaced. All caps, filters, and resistors were checked and replaced as needed. All brittle or bare wiring was replaced or re-insulated. The chassis has been cleaned, lubed, and re-aligned for optimal performance. Using the included copper line antenna the radio performs very well. The Cabinets Finish and Restoration Process: Our Radio cabinets undergo a vigorous restoration process. Our goal is to maintain the natural beauty of the wood and grain, while providing a deep luster and shine. We achieve this by removing all the old and worn lacquers and stains. We then sand the cabinet with fine grit pads down to the original bare wood. Nicks, chips, and blemishes are filled and/or blended. Any loose veneer is re-secured. We make sure any filler applied or repairs made are blended nicely and do not detract from the beauty of the set unless otherwise noted. New stains and sealers are applied by hand. We continue by using many coats of Mohawk brand lacquers and toners applied in the same manner as when the radio was originally finished in the factory. We use a nitrocellulose piano lacquer which is applied through a professional HVLP turbine spray system in a climate controlled room. Nitrocellulose lacquer is very thin. We also apply very thin coats. This allows the lacquer to seep into the grain and not cover it up. A fine grit wet sanding follows every third coat along with a polishing process and ending with an Oz glaze rub. Many hours of work are put into the radios, but as you can see, the final outcome is a beautiful, natural looking cabinet with gorgeous luster& shine.
